Mission Statement
“Our mission is to encourage an appreciation and interest in the history, art, and culture of our community and state.”
Displays on the main level are changed every year, so there is always something new to see. The lower level is dedicated to agriculture and farm life and also houses an educational area which is supported by the local FFA chapter members. Visitors will find this area interesting and informative, and in 2008 it will test your knowledge of corn.
The Museum is directed by a seven member board which is appointed by the City Council. It employs six part-time employees - 4 tour guides, a senior associate, and janitor. The Board of Directors is pleased to announce the hiring Rosemary Schwartz as the new part-time Director of the museum. Her duties include, research of fund raising opportunities, grant writing, overseeing of museum events, and public relations. Ms. Schwartz has a Master’s Degree in Youth and Human Services Administration and has over 10 years of experience of successful fund raising and event management experience. She currently resides in Vinton. “I was immediately impressed with what the museum has to offer to the area. The museum is truly a jewel for the area that should not be overlooked. I look forward to working with the Board, staff, and volunteers to spread the word about this unique facility.” Ms. Schwartz commented.
